Q: How do I book the wellness room at Orrin Park?

A: Book via the Quietly app, max 60 minutes per day. Slots release at 8am. No meetings, no calls — it's for rest, prayer, or pumping. Cancel if you can't make it; no-shows get flagged after three strikes. The door stays locked between bookings. Once your slot is confirmed, let yourself in with the code below.

badge for fafop-fajof: bdg-Z-47

**Q: How do I open the shuttle-bus gate?**

The shuttle from Pemberly Park pulls up at the side gate roughly every twenty minutes. Reception controls that gate — don't buzz it open without seeing the driver's pass first. If the intercom's playing up (it often does), you can release the gate manually from the keypad using the code below.

staff pass of kawip-hawef = bdg-QLP-2

## Tax-Rate Lookup Cache

The Ledgerline tax-rate cache is warmed automatically two hours before each release cut. Release managers should confirm the warm-up job completed in the Pipeline view; shipping with a cold cache causes first-request latency spikes in checkout. If the job shows amber, rerun it once — repeated failures mean upstream rate tables are stale. For stale-table investigations, contact the tax platform team.

escalation mailbox, bafog-fafog: ulador@paliqlabs.internal